Whatever this converter is, its either a Half Bridge or a 2 Tran Forward......the lack of an (as yet) identifiable half bridge driver (hi side then lo side etc etc) says its a 2 Tran Forward. The split coil output says Half bridge, but it could be a 2 Tran forward with 2 secondaries feeding into the same C(out) via separate diodes. The lack of (as yet) identifiable reset diodes tells against the 2 Tran Forward. The split rail caps at pri side tell of half bridge, but could just be feeding a 2TF.
The thing thats for definite, is that its using the transformer leakage inductance as the main "output" inductor. (since the only output inductor seen is 7 torroids round the output busbar). As such, i am not expecting the transformer turns ratio to be anything "usual".